Hi, Ruth. I would take my BP the next time it happens, just to see. And your heart rate, too. I'd also keep a record of what I'd eaten on the day that I got these episodes, since many foods and herbs and medications interact with Coumadin - making it either weaker or more powerful depending on the interaction.
